i could confirm the MU-MIMO is working with AP and other MU-MIMO cell phones as Samsung S7. while Intel 8265 is working on 11ac mode, but only SU-MIMO, not MU-MIMO.

Below is how i can prove my conclusion:

AP will send all MU-MIMO supported client a VHT NDP packets to request client send MU feedback, while the Intel 8265 always send feedback as SU feedback, so AP cannot perform MU-MIMO.

on the contrary, samsung S7 could reply MU feedback to the AP.

it is not true that Intel 8265 is working on 11n mode, because it is tested and captured all packets between Intel 8265 and AP are in 11ac mode with Channel 149; BUT it just working on the SU-MIMO mode as I said above.

Do NOT use MU-MIMO on the AC88U or any Broadcom chipset based router as it will actually reduce performance. Even Broadcom clients like the Galaxy S7/S8 drop to a single antenna mode with MU enabled, though it's not a big difference as it's just a phone. Basically Broadcom has a improper half hazard implementation of MU-MIMO.

Only routers based on the Qualcomm QCA9984 chipset actually give a decent performance gain with MU-MIMO like the Netgear R7800, Synology RT2600AC and Asus BRT-AC828.

Having said that, how many MU clients do you actually have? You need two or more MU capable clients for MU-MIMO to actually work. MU means the router will use two (Dual Antenna) MU clients at once or 3 (Single Antenna) clients or 1 (Single Antenna) and 1 (Dual Antenna) client at once. If you only have one MU capable client obviously it can't use MU-MIMO.
